About The Book

From New York Times bestselling author Melissa Foster comes The Whiskeys: Dark Knights at Redemption Ranch, a small-town, big-family series of standalone romance novels featuring fiercely loyal, insanely sexy bikers who give horses—and people—a second chance. Buckle up for a wild ride in Hope Ridge, Colorado, as these big-hearted badasses and their sassy sisters wrangle in their forever loves. No cliffhangers, no cheating, and always a happily ever after.

He’s a natural-born protector, a Dark Knights biker, and a hell of a rancher. What happens when he falls for a woman who has no idea who she really is?
When Sullivan Tate escaped from a cult, leaving behind the only life she’d ever known, she thought she’d already endured the most difficult things she’d ever have to deal with. She knew she needed to figure out who she was, but she hadn’t expected to fall for overprotective and sexy-as-hell Callahan “Cowboy” Whiskey along the way. How can she give her heart to a man who has always known exactly who he is, when she’s only just begun figuring that out about herself?

Summary

Sullivan “Sully” Tate, was raised in a cult where she was abused by men but especially the cult leader and she found a way to escape and is now in hiding. And then she finds a home and safe harbor with the Whiskeys at the Redemption Ranch, where they rescue lost souls and animals and get them on the road to healing and recovery. And this is where Sully meets one of the sons of the Whiskeys who run the Redemption Ranch. And Cowboy is the broody serious son. He is the protector and helps the most with damaged and abused horses. But for Sully, he is her safe haven, she feels more safe in his arms than anywhere else. But as they develop a strong bond, Cowboy is hesitant to move faster than he should with Sully, he knows that she is recovering and he doesn’t want to push her too fast. But Sully knows that even though their relationship is new, and she is learning to heal, she also knows that you fight for who you love…

What I Loved

This book was simply everything! I adored every single aspect of this story. And what I loved the most was the focus on the healing and balancing it out with a romantic relationship. There is such a authentic feel to how Melissa Foster captures the essence of the heart between these two characters. And how good they are for each other. I was instantly drawn into their relationship, because you can sense their deep connection from the very beginning. I couldn’t seem to get enough between these two. And they were truly so delightful to see together and the in which they just lift each other up in the right ways. I have read plenty of healing romances but this is hands down the best one that I have ever had the pleasure to read. In this story we see such a strong delivery of balance of chemistry and deep connection. Cowboy is such a protector but isn’t overbearing or overstep at all, and when Sully stands her ground, he respects her even more. But he is his own man and he makes his own decisions and I love that he does what he believes is right even if his family disagrees. I loved seeing him come into his own and fight for his woman. Both Sully and Cowboy have to learn to fight for each other and it epic when they do it when it counts and do it TOGETHER!! And that ending, my heart just crashed. This author just tore me up with so much intense emotion and seeing what happens to bring them to their HEA was brilliant and so poignant, I guarantee it will be a moment that as a reader you can easily get so lost in.
